Notes
The date of rubrication 1461 is found on a single leaf, Paris BN (DeR(M) 23,13), formerly the last leaf of the Wolfenbüttel HAB copy. For arguments favouring Gutenberg as printer see G.D. Painter, in D.E. Rhodes (ed.), Essays in honour of Victor Scholderer (Mainz, 1970) pp.292-322. Polain assigns to Mainz, before 1460. – Some copies have (fragments of) a printed rubrication guide in six leaves: Bamberg SB, Cambridge UL, Halle ULB, München BSB, Paris BN (cf. B. Pfeil, Ein weiteres Fragment des 'Registrum rubricarum' der 36zeiligen Bibel - http://www.db-thueringen.de/servlets/DerivateServlet/Derivate-14371/fragment_registrum.pdf). – Eric White argues for Pfister as the printer of the Bible and provides information about several copies, cf. E.M. White, New Provenances for Four Copies of the 36-Line Bible, in: The Book Collector 62:3 (2013), pp.403–434
